Mystery Snails — Colorful, Peaceful Tank Cleaners
Mystery Snails (Pomacea bridgesii) are large, peaceful freshwater snails available in stunning pink, purple, and yellow color morphs. Unlike most snails, they won't eat your live plants and they don't reproduce out of control in freshwater — making them an ideal choice for planted tanks and community setups. Their large size and gentle grazing make them mesmerizing to watch as they clean glass, decor, and substrate.
Care Guide
- Tank size: 5 gallons minimum per snail; they produce more waste than smaller species
- Water parameters: Temp 68–82°F, pH 7.0–8.0, GH 8–18 (hard water is essential for shell health)
- Diet: Omnivore — algae wafers, blanched vegetables (zucchini, spinach), sinking pellets, and leftover food. Calcium supplementation is critical for strong shells
- Tankmates: Peaceful with shrimp, snails, and community fish (tetras, rasboras, corydoras). Avoid loaches, pufferfish, cichlids, and assassin snails

🐠 Acclimation Guide
- Temperature Match:
Make sure the bag water is close to your tank temperature. - Float the Bag:
Place the sealed bag in your tank for 15–20 minutes. - Water Mixing:
Gradually add small amounts of tank water into the bag over 15–20 minutes. - Release:
Gently net the fish into the tank.
❗ Do not pour bag water into your tank to avoid contamination.
